预处理-超滤-反渗透工艺深度处理炼油厂污水

摘    要:采用预处理-超滤-反渗透工艺深度处理某炼油厂污水场的二沉池出水。预处理单元出水COD为40mg/L,ρ(NH3-N)为1mg/L,SS为6.3mg/L,能够满足超滤-反渗透系统的进水要求。超滤单元进水压力在0.04~0.08MPa波动,反渗透单元进水压力在0.92~1.12MPa波动,运行均稳定,化学清洗周期均可超过一个月。预处理-超滤-反渗透工艺产水回用于二级脱盐装置脱盐水补水的成本为每吨产水2.04元,低于企业现有的新鲜水每吨3.45元的费用。该优质产水取代新鲜水回用,每年可为企业节约100多万元。

Advanced Treatment of Refinery Wastewater by Pretreatment-Ultrafiltration-Reverse Osmosis Process

Abstract:The secondary sedimentation tank effluent of a refinery wastewater treatment plant was treated by pretreatment-ultrafiltration-reverse osmosis process. The COD,ρ(NH3-N) and SS of the effluent of the pretreatment unit are 40,1,6.3 mg/L respectively,which can meet the requirements of influent quality for the ultrafiltration-reverse osmosis units. When the influent pressure of ultrafiltration unit is 0.04-0.08 MPa and that of reverse osmosis unit is 0.92-1.12 MPa,the two units can run steadily,and the chemical cleaning period is over 1 month. The treated water can be reused as make-up water for secondary desalter,its cost is 2.04 yuan per ton,less than 3.45 yuan per ton of fresh water cost. With the reuse of the treated water,the enterprise can save more than 1 million yuan per year.
